The Behaviour Support Plan Content Appraisal Tool (BSP-CAT) is a free tool to assess and improve the quality of behaviour support plans for people with learning disabilities with a history of displaying behaviours that challenge. It has 14 components for plan evaluation, organised into 6 strands:
-
-
- Foundations for support
-
- Enabling environments
-
- Antecedent interventions
-
- Skills development
-
- Reactive strategies
-
- Implementation and monitoring of the plan
The BSP-CAT User’s Manual provides guidance for people with relevant training and experience on how to use the BSP-CAT through self-instruction.
